Output 3c0ba515caf42d0713066ee9c80c0363478de2c27c950b923233eee381224317:0

value
6196000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51d4634c0adcc7c82f9560b55dbf643d9f967c4 OP_EQUAL
address
3M7rvQwo2dTsJCQzcRhK4Xbg8cYNJ3tekF
transaction
3c0ba515caf42d0713066ee9c80c0363478de2c27c950b923233eee381224317
confirmations
394940
spent
true